🗺️ Detailed Itinerary
📍 Day 1: Hue → Cua Tung Beach
Distance: 150 km | Riding Time: ~5 hours
- Depart from Hue via peaceful Tam Giang Lagoon
- Visit Xia Fishing Village — interact with fishermen & take scenic photos
- Explore Long Hung Church and Quang Tri Old Citadel
- Discover the Vinh Moc Tunnels — underground wartime shelter
- Pass by the DMZ – 17th Parallel
- Check-in at a hotel by the tranquil Cua Tung Beach, relax & stay overnight
📍 Day 2: Cua Tung Beach → Khe Sanh
Distance: 160 km | Riding Time: ~5 hours
- Ride through green jungles & rubber plantations
- Learn how locals collect latex and black pepper
- Journey along National Route 9, stopping at:
- Dakrong Bridge
- Rock Pile Hill
- Camp Carol
- To Con Airport

📍 Day 3: Khe Sanh → Phong Nha
Distance: 220 km | Riding Time: ~7 hours
- Visit Khe Sanh Combat Base & Museum
- Ride the West Ho Chi Minh Trail through:
- Towering limestone karsts
- Old-growth jungles
- Remote ethnic minority villages
